On Sun, Jan 10, 2021 at 10:33:16AM +0900, Minwoo Im wrote:
> Hello,
> 
> On 21-01-09 20:34:11, Chaitanya Kulkarni wrote:
> > On 1/8/21 06:54, Minwoo Im wrote:
> > > This feature can be applied not only I/O queue commands, but also admin
> > > queue commands.  Admin command during the initialization may fail due to
> > > some un-ready state of a controller, so it would be better to have this
> > > feature for admin commands also.
> > What is some un-ready state ?
> 
> State that controller is unable to process successfully command as
> "Command Interrupt" status code represents.

Given that controller ready has a specific meaning in NVMe I think a
different wording here would be useful.
